About

Xiaojuan Zhao is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Xiaojuan Zhao has authored 59 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Molecular Biology, 11 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 11 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Xiaojuan Zhao’s work include Diet, Metabolism, and Disease (8 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(5 papers) and Esophageal Cancer Research and Treatment (5 papers). Xiaojuan Zhao is often cited by papers focused on Diet, Metabolism, and Disease (8 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(5 papers) and Esophageal Cancer Research and Treatment (5 papers). Xiaojuan Zhao collaborates with scholars based in China, The Netherlands and United States. Xiaojuan Zhao's co-authors include Ling‐Dong Kong, Yan‐Zi Yang, Rui‐Qing Jiao, Tianyu Chen, Lin-Lin Kang, Hanwen Yu, Wen‐Yuan Wu, Keke Jia, Ying Pan and Erfei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Applied Catalysis B Environment and Energy and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
